Oster Blender Buying Guide for Salsa
Motor Power and Speed
For salsa, motor power is critical. A 700-watt motor can handle most salsa ingredients, but for thick, chunky salsas with lots of ice or frozen ingredients, 1000+ watts is better. Variable speeds allow you to control texture from chunky to smooth. Pulse function is useful for a coarse chop.
Jar Material and Size
Glass jars are heavier but resist scratching and staining from tomatoes and peppers. Plastic jars are lighter but can absorb odors. A 40-48 oz jar (5-6 cups) is ideal for batch salsa. Smaller jars (20 oz) are fine for single servings but require more chopping.
Blade and Drive Design
Stainless steel blades with a serrated edge crush ice effectively. A removable blade assembly makes cleaning easier. The drive coupling (where the jar connects to the base) should be metal to avoid stripping. Plastic drives are common on budget models and may fail with heavy use.

FAQ
Can I make chunky salsa in an Oster blender?
Yes, use the pulse function or low speed for a few seconds to achieve a chunky texture. Over-blending will make it smooth.
Is a glass jar better for salsa?
Yes, glass is non-porous and won’t absorb tomato odors or stains. It’s also heavier and more stable on the base.
How do I clean my Oster blender after making salsa?
Rinse immediately with warm water and a drop of dish soap, then blend on high for 30 seconds. Rinse again. The glass jar is dishwasher safe.
